Output e31e3ac665310f580b2016a9ae17d5e62c2810843d58c8b2b0d1a6aa44e0a431:0

value
33646700
script pubkey
OP_0 OP_PUSHBYTES_20 d4eb80979354d2ea79d892777ba312d04242f5a5
address
bc1q6n4cp9un2nfw57wcjfmhhgcj6ppy9ad9pknpte
transaction
e31e3ac665310f580b2016a9ae17d5e62c2810843d58c8b2b0d1a6aa44e0a431